Job description
Application close: July 17, 2026, 4:30 p.m. We need a self-motivated individual to fill the following vacancy that exists. This position offers great growth potential.
MINIMUM REQUIREMENTS**:**
- Matric or equivalent qualification
- Six months retail experience, essential
- Team Player
- Good communication skills
- Good Customer Service
- Positive attitude
RESPONSIBILTIES**:**
- Provide friendly and efficient customer service.
- Assist customers with product information, locating items, and making purchases.
- Maintain store cleanliness, including shelves, displays, and checkout areas.
- Ensure merchandise is neatly packed, priced, and well-presented.
- Replenish stock on the shelves and monitor product levels.
- Operate the cash register and handle transactions accurately.
- Follow store policies, safety procedures, and loss-prevention guidelines.
- Support the team with general store duties as needed.
- Ad hoc duties
